|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face AtlassianBootstrapManager
Parent BootstrapManaager
Method Summary | |
---|---|
void |
bootstrapDatabase(DatabaseDetails dbDetails,
boolean embedded)
|
void |
bootstrapDatasource(java.lang.String datasourceName,
java.lang.String hibernateDialect)
|
boolean |
databaseContainsExistingData(java.sql.Connection connection)
|
ApplicationConfiguration |
getApplicationConfig()
|
java.lang.String |
getApplicationHome()
|
java.lang.String |
getBootstrapFailureReason()
|
java.lang.String |
getBuildNumber()
This is the build number of the current version that the user is running under. |
java.lang.String |
getConfiguredApplicationHome()
|
java.lang.String |
getFilePathProperty(java.lang.String key)
|
HibernateConfig |
getHibernateConfig()
|
HibernateConfigurator |
getHibernateConfigurator()
|
java.util.Properties |
getHibernateProperties()
|
java.lang.String |
getOperation()
|
java.util.Map |
getPropertiesWithPrefix(java.lang.String prefix)
|
java.lang.Object |
getProperty(java.lang.String key)
|
java.util.Collection |
getPropertyKeys()
|
SetupPersister |
getSetupPersister()
|
java.lang.String |
getString(java.lang.String key)
|
java.sql.Connection |
getTestDatabaseConnection(DatabaseDetails databaseDetails)
|
java.sql.Connection |
getTestDatasourceConnection(java.lang.String datasourceName)
|
void |
init()
Does final initialisation of the BootstrapManager, including looking up the confluence home (Previously was the afterPropertiesSet method) |
boolean |
isApplicationHomeValid()
|
boolean |
isBootstrapped()
|
boolean |
isPropertyTrue(java.lang.String prop)
|
boolean |
isSetupComplete()
|
void |
publishConfiguration()
|
void |
removeProperty(java.lang.String key)
|
void |
save()
|
void |
setBuildNumber(java.lang.String buildNumber)
|
void |
setHibernateConfigurator(HibernateConfigurator hibernateConfigurator)
|
void |
setOperation(java.lang.String operation)
|
void |
setProperty(java.lang.String key,
java.lang.Object value)
|
void |
setSetupComplete(boolean complete)
|
Method Detail |
---|
boolean isBootstrapped()
java.lang.Object getProperty(java.lang.String key)
void setProperty(java.lang.String key, java.lang.Object value)
boolean isPropertyTrue(java.lang.String prop)
void removeProperty(java.lang.String key)
java.lang.String getString(java.lang.String key)
java.lang.String getFilePathProperty(java.lang.String key)
java.util.Collection getPropertyKeys()
java.util.Map getPropertiesWithPrefix(java.lang.String prefix)
java.lang.String getBuildNumber()
void setBuildNumber(java.lang.String buildNumber)
boolean isApplicationHomeValid()
java.util.Properties getHibernateProperties()
void save() throws ConfigurationException
ConfigurationException
boolean isSetupComplete()
java.lang.String getOperation()
void setOperation(java.lang.String operation)
void setSetupComplete(boolean complete)
void bootstrapDatasource(java.lang.String datasourceName, java.lang.String hibernateDialect) throws BootstrapException
BootstrapException
SetupPersister getSetupPersister()
ApplicationConfiguration getApplicationConfig()
java.lang.String getApplicationHome()
java.lang.String getConfiguredApplicationHome()
java.lang.String getBootstrapFailureReason()
void init() throws BootstrapException
BootstrapException
void publishConfiguration()
void bootstrapDatabase(DatabaseDetails dbDetails, boolean embedded) throws BootstrapException
BootstrapException
HibernateConfigurator getHibernateConfigurator()
void setHibernateConfigurator(HibernateConfigurator hibernateConfigurator)
HibernateConfig getHibernateConfig()
java.sql.Connection getTestDatasourceConnection(java.lang.String datasourceName) throws BootstrapException
BootstrapException
boolean databaseContainsExistingData(java.sql.Connection connection)
java.sql.Connection getTestDatabaseConnection(DatabaseDetails databaseDetails) throws BootstrapException
BootstrapException
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|